905586-88-1,905586-93-8,864517-99-7,864525-21-3,864527-83-3,864527-95-7 Supplier | ORGCHEMI.COM
CMO CDMO service. ORGCHEMI.COM supply 905586-88-1,905586-93-8,864517-99-7,864525-21-3,864527-83-3,864527-95-7 and related compounds.
864525-21-3
905586-88-1
905586-93-8
864517-99-7
864527-95-7
864527-83-3